Good day , being a bit of a noob to Guzzi but loving every minute of it , I have a question regarding the 1100 engines in both the 2007 Griso 1100  and the 2007 Cali 1100 Vintage..
In this case the sumps , my Griso has a spin on oil filter easy accessible from the bottom of the pan /sump ..the Cali requires that you remove the pan to get to the oil filter ...that being said can you bolt on the Griso sump to the Cali to simplify oil changes ?
I know that there are aftermarket solutions to the Cali re filter location , but we wonder at using stock parts for the switch as well.
Are the two engines different as to parts in other ways as well?
the only thing we know for sure is that the Griso is a 6 speed and the Cali 5  :boozing:

The depth of the sump and spacer will probably be a problem and you need the spacer because it's what all the gubbins hangs off inside. You'll also need to mount an oil cooler or bypass hose.
